U.S.'s Kerry says Iran nuclear deal needs to be stronger

Description

In Paris, U.S. Secretary of State John Kerry says the U.S. and France agree that the nuclear deal between Iran and the P5 + 1 needs to be stronger. Rough Cut (no reporter narration).
